In the 4.0.4-dev tree we added a check not to allow non-variables to be
sent by reference. It seems to have broken some people's scripts. Can you
please let us know if you're one of them and possibly a very short (very
short :) reproducing script?
I also have a trial patch ready but it still isn't a closed issue as to
what is the best way to handle it. Any feedback we can get from you guys
would give us enough information to think of what to do.
